Thiol-specific peroxidase that catalyzes the reduction of hydrogen peroxide and organic hydroperoxides to water and alcohols, respectively.
Can reduce H(2)O(2) and short chain organic, fatty acid, and phospholipid hydroperoxides.
Also has phospholipase activity, and can therefore either reduce the oxidized sn-2 fatty acyl grup of phospholipids (peroxidase activity) or hydrolyze the sn-2 ester bond of phospholipids (phospholipase activity).
These activities are dependent on binding to phospholipids at acidic pH and to oxidized phospholipds at cytosolic pH.
Plays a role in cell protection against oxidative stress by detoxifying peroxides and in phospholipid homeostasis.
